Top 10 Most Caffeinated Hot Drink At Starbucks Highest To Lowest

You have been warned, all of these drinks are highly caffeinated with enough to make most people feel sick.

Let’s get started with this top 10 list of the most caffeinated hot drink at Starbucks.

#1 Venti 20 (600 ml) Blonde Roast Brewed Coffee – 475 mg

This is simply drip coffee, filter coffee in a light roast, a tasty blonde roast that is a blend of East African and Latin American coffee beans.

It’s light and bright and goes incredibly well with a couple of pumps of vanilla syrup and if you must add steamed milk consider an alternative milk like oat milk or almond milk and as far as the energy boost goes, it’s the equivalent of more than six shots of espresso.

Even the smaller drinks sizes kick like a mule and contain the following amounts of caffeine:

  • Grande 16 Oz (480 ml): 360 mg.
  • Tall 12 Oz (360 ml): 270 mg.
  • Short 8 Oz (240 ml): 180 mg.

180 mg is a good caffeine kick, more than a double shot of espresso.

#2 Venti 20 Oz (600 ml) Clover Brewed Coffee Reserve Roast – 470 mg

Clover brewed coffee is nice, tasty and uses a full immersion vacuum-press brewing technique that is exclusive to Starbucks.

You will not get this coffee or a brewing method like it at your local coffee shop. It’s a combination of vacuum brewing and press brewing, hence the term vacuum-press. The technique extracts some unique flavors from the coffee that other methods are not capable of.

Definitely worth trying, not for the stunning 470 mg caffeine kick but for the rather tasty, lovely coffee produced. Enjoy it as black coffee or with a splash of coconut milk, or oat milk.

On its own, it is a Starbucks drink that you can authentically say is healthy due to the low calorie count (5) and the fact that it has no fat or sugar – unless you add steamed milk or syrup.

#2 Venti 20 Oz (600 ml) Clover Brewed Coffee Dark Roast – 470 mg

This is deep, intense and great tasting dark roast coffee. It is neat and a very nice coffee in its own without anything added. Black coffee lovers will enjoy it.

#4 Venti 20 Oz (600 ml) Clover Brewed Coffee Medium Roast – 445 mg

As a very positive note, all of these so far are healthy Starbucks drinks with only a grand total of 5 calories per drink and no sugar and no fat as long as you are not adding steamed milk or syrup of any type to sweeten it.

That is quite a statement from me, a coffee lover that considers Starbucks to be liquid cakes, which most drinks are due to the high amount of sugar, fat and calories.

With a caffeine content of 445 mg it has enough coffee, with 600 ml, 20 Oz for two people, even three with 200 ml each (6.66 Oz) and just less than 150 mg caffeine each.

#5 Venti 20 Oz (600 ml) Clover Brewed Coffee Blonde Roast – 425 mg

As I warned earlier, all the drinks on this list are highly caffeinated and half of them are either regular brewed coffee or clover brewed coffee.

Volume plays a large role in the total caffeine content of a drink. The bigger the drink, the more caffeine you will consume. Even though caffeine concentration, the amount of caffeine per ounce (per 30 ml) may be lower than an espresso, ristretto or lungo but the sheer volume more than makes up for it.

This blonde roast, if you don’t enjoy the natural flavor of it, add a pump of vanilla syrup and a splash of steamed milk to this Starbucks coffee.

While this may not be the strongest coffee, don’t forget that it is still the equivalent of more than 5 shots of espresso.

#6 Venti 20 Oz (600 ml) Pike Place Brewed Coffee – 410 mg

While just outside the top Strongest coffee drink, Pike Place is strong coffee while not quite tasting like a strong coffee.

It’s a medium roast with more than its fair share of caffeine and goes brilliantly with cream.

Personally, I enjoy making this (at home) using the pour over method rather than drip coffee.

The pour over gets more flavor into coffee than any other brewing method due to having a greater amount of total dissolved solids than other brewing methods.

If you love to make coffee at home, try this Starbucks drink in store and if you enjoy it you can buy a bag of their beans.

#7 Venti 20 Oz (600 ml) Blonde Caffé Americano – 340 mg

This is still a serious drink in terms of caffeine, despite a drop in the caffeine stakes from 410 mg to 340 mg It is still 4 shots of blonde espresso and anyone that has tried drinking four shots back to back or in a short period of time will know there is a very serious caffeine buzz.

If you have not quite tried an Americano before and get put off with the thought of a strong black coffee fear not it is a very light tasting coffee, and you can add a couple of pumps of vanilla to sweeten the drink and take the edge off of the bitter notes.

Adding steamed milk turns this into tasty blonde misto Americano! Nice.

#8 Venti 20 Oz (600 ml) Featured Dark Roast Brewed Coffee – 340 mg

This is an amazing coffee if you are a lover of deep, dark roast coffees. Due to the depth of flavor and intensity I suspect that this is an Italian roast.

It’s strong, tasty and full bodies and enjoyable with milk too as the strength cuts easily past the milk.

#9 Venti 20 Oz (600 ml) Cordusio Mocha – 320 mg

This is a very strong mocha made with 4 shots of espresso and equal amounts of both steamed milk and rich dark chocolate. A cordusio mocha is more caffeinated than regular mocha drinks due to being made with extra shots of espresso.

The caffeine high or buzz is neatly calmed down due to the presence of the chocolate. Mochas are better if you need to concentrate, study or work.

#10 Venti 20 Oz (600 ml) Caffé Americano – 300 mg

Made with 4 shots of Starbucks signature espresso roast you can expect this to be strong, bold and tasty as well as packing a strong caffeine kick.

Frequently Asked Questions About High Caffeine Starbucks Drinks

How Much Caffeine Is In Starbucks Coffee Grounds?

Coffee grounds are not measured by the caffeine content as there are various factors that determine how much caffeine is in a cup of coffee, including:

  • Brew temperature.
  • Brewing methods.
  • The amount of coffee used.
  • The coffee to water ratio.
  • The volume of the drink in total.
  • The type of beans.

You can make a dozen or more different cups of coffee with the same beans and get different tasting coffees with a different amount of caffeine.

Which Coffee Shop Coffee Has The Most Caffeine?

Having checked McDonald’s, Costa Coffee, Horton’s, Dunkins, Caribou and various other coffee outlets, it is Starbucks that are unquestionably the kings of caffeine.

Some come close but none match the caffeine content of their Venti blonde roast brewed coffee which has 475 mg and their clover brewed coffee dark roast and reserve roast which have 470 mg of caffeine.

Which Frappuccino Has The Most Caffeine?

The Venti espresso Frappuccino with 185 mg of caffeine is the Frappuccino that has the greatest caffeine content.

How Much Caffeine Is Too Much A Day?

The recommended daily amount of caffeine per day is 400 milligrams of caffeine. Anything over this amount is too much.

For pregnant ladies, 200 mg per day is the recommended daily maximum, thus anything over 200 mg per day is too much for expectant ladies.

Is Americano Stronger Than Espresso?

No, an Americano is not stronger than espresso. It is not weaker either. An Americano is made with shots of espresso ranging from 1 to 4 and has 75 mg to 300 mg of caffeine depending on the drink size ordered.

Obviously a Tall Americano with 2 shots of espresso is stronger than a single shot of espresso and has the same amount of caffeine as double espresso.

Which Is Stronger Latte Or Cappuccino?

Both a latte and a cappuccino are made with the same number of shots for the respective drink sizes and thus have the same amount of caffeine.

A cappuccino has a stronger flavor due to the espresso to milk ratio of 1:1 compared to the espresso to milk ratio of a latte which is 1:2 making it a milder coffee in terms of flavor.
